What Changed

The Bloomsbury Institute in London has had its license to sponsor international students revoked, putting current students' visa statuses at risk and affecting future recruitment.

What It Means for Indian Students

  • Current students might need to transfer institutions to maintain visa status.
  • Indicates a possible tightening of UK visa sponsorship regulations.
  • Prospective students should verify the sponsor status of their chosen institutions.
  • Highlights the importance of choosing well-established universities with strong records.

Action Checklist

  • Verify the visa sponsorship status of institutions before applying.
  • For current students, consult legal advice on maintaining student status.
  • Explore alternative institutions in the UK with secure sponsorship licenses.
  • Stay informed about UK's growing scrutiny on visa sponsor protocols.
